Carbon Adds Over 950 Markets to Its On Chain Trading Platform
Carbon is bridging the gap between TradFi and crypto by allowing users to trade stocks, forex, and commodities directly from their own wallets.
coinbeat.newsCarbon has officially launched a new suite of over 250 traditional financial markets on its on chain platform. Traders can now access a total of 950 instruments, including global equities, forex pairs, and commodities, alongside their existing crypto perpetuals and real world assets. By hedging every position one to one with regulated off chain brokers, the platform provides institutional depth from the moment a market opens.
This update solves a major hurdle for decentralized finance, which is the lack of deep liquidity for real world assets. Instead of waiting for liquidity to build up in an order book, traders get the full depth of established global markets. Because the system hedges through regulated venues, users benefit from professional execution while keeping full control of their assets in self custody wallets.
Beyond just trading, Carbon is introducing a yield product called the Carbon Liquidity Provider vault. This allows users to earn returns by funding the hedges behind trade flow. With a focus on speed, the team plans to add 150 more listings to the platform soon.
